可以通过以下方法用 JavaScript 获取类名元素:document.getElementsByClassName() 返回具有指定类名的所有元素。document.querySelector() 返回匹配指定类名的第一个元素。document.querySelectorAll() 返回匹配指定类名的所有元素。Element.classList 判断元素是否具有特定类名并操作类名列表。
如何用 JavaScript 获取类名元素
在 JavaScript 中,可以通过以下几种方法获取具有特定类名的元素:
1. document.getElementsByClassName()
此方法返回一个类似数组的对象,其中包含具有指定类名的所有元素。
// 所有具有 "my-class" 类名的元素const elements = document.getElementsByClassName("my-class");// 获取第一个元素const firstElement = elements[0];
登录后复制
2. document.querySelector()
此方法返回匹配指定选择器(包括类名)的第一个元素。它使用 CSS 选择器语法。
// 具有 "my-class" 类名的第一个元素const firstElement = document.querySelector(".my-class");
登录后复制
3. document.querySelectorAll()
此方法返回一个类似数组的对象,其中包含匹配指定选择器(包括类名)的所有元素。它也使用 CSS 选择器语法。
// 所有具有 "my-class" 类名的元素const elements = document.querySelectorAll(".my-class");
登录后复制
4. Element.classList
每个元素都有一个 classList 属性,它是一个表示元素当前类名列表的 DOMTokenList 对象。
// 具有 "my-class" 类名的元素const element = document.getElementById("my-element");// 判断元素是否具有 "my-class" 类名if (element.classList.contains("my-class")) { // 执行某些操作}
登录后复制
通过使用这些方法,可以轻松地获取和操作具有特定类名的元素。
以上就是js怎么获取class的元素的详细内容,更多请关注【创想鸟】其它相关文章!
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至253000106@qq.com举报,一经查实,本站将立刻删除。
发布者:PHP中文网,转转请注明出处:https://www.chuangxiangniao.com/p/2674460.html